5a1c2f825419b918c1e4dd6205d8339a6e9e316f6a4475ffc4764f3a01ec0279

1826546 (4017 blocks ago)

⏴ Block 1826545 (6756ae29…3a5) | Block 1826547 ⏵ | Latest block ⏭

Metadata

15/04/2025, 12:54 UTC (5d 13:55:06 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details